Output 0ec7d4df38ddcf2c594e9bf6f84b775024905fb5579ca0a0edc87e32768d8400:123

value
127140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e850d63d9194bbb63d5b949f9249d876416c532 OP_EQUAL
address
3BmPeHGa8mruEUk5VnetCxk31GMxK2Y97H
transaction
0ec7d4df38ddcf2c594e9bf6f84b775024905fb5579ca0a0edc87e32768d8400
confirmations
172985
spent
true